Responsibilities
End-to-End Interaction Engineering: Translate high-level business goals and technical parameters into functional user flows, wireframes, rapid prototypes, and polished, high-fidelity user interface designs.
Complex Workflow Simplification: Analyze information-dense panels, enterprise interfaces, and multi-step processes, re-engineering them into intuitive, efficient, and friction-free user journeys for both web and mobile formats.
Cross-Functional Collaboration: Partner actively with Product Managers and Software Developers to balance user empathy with technical execution constraints, ensuring design fidelity throughout the production implementation phase.
Design System Stewardship: Operate fluently within established global design systems, ensuring all assets adhere to component rules while contributing to the evolution of reusable UI patterns.
Design Critiques & Alignment: Participate in peer design reviews, giving and receiving constructive critique to maintain aesthetic quality, layout consistency, and unified brand expression across modules.
User-Centric Advocacy: Incorporate qualitative user feedback, research insights, and data analytics into tactical design updates, continuously advocating for accessibility, usability, and industry-best design practices within an Agile sprint delivery cycle.
